GeneralCurrently interested in: CD, CD-R, 3" Minidisc, Business card CDR, mp3, Vinyl, cassette tape, VHS, microcassette, reel-to-reel, Yak-Bak, playable sculpture.

Not interested in: Beta, 8-track, wire recorder, tinfoil, wax cylinder, punchcard, archeoacoustics, long-winded elderly persons.

About me:

"It's Too Damn Early" is a weekly, experimental show broadcast from WDBX 91.1 FM, a not-for-profit community radio station in Southern Illinois.
The Official ITDE Website

ITDE features electroacoustic, drone, noise, avant-garde, improvisation, collage, sound art, oddmusic, and difficult listening of all types.
